Cavusoglu: our aim was to set PACE Sub-Committee on Karabakh, and we did itApril 6, 2011 - 21:38 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- President of the Parliamentary Assembly of the Council of Europe (PACE) Mevlut Cavusoglu arrived in Azerbaijan to attend the World Forum on Intercultural Dialogue. Commenting on sittings of the PACE Sub-Committee on Nagorno Karabakh, Cavusoglu told journalists: “Members of the PACE Sub-Committee on Nagorno Karabakh will determine themselves the sitting’s date and issues that will be discussed.” He reminded about appointment of the sub-committee head and members: “Our aim was to set up this committee, and we did it. The task of PACE is to support the conflict resolution. The OSCE Minsk Group keeps on working on this issue. Our goal is not to interfere in it. Both parties must trust each other. The Sub-Committee on Nagorno Karabakh was set up with good intentions. PACE adopted the decision on its establishment. The assembly members should also observe it and attend the sittings. The Armenian side will make the decision on its sittings attendance itself. We can’t make any decision on this issue.” Answering the question on opening of an international airport in Stepanakert and Armenia’s plan to organize flights to this airport, Cavusoglu said the Azerbaijani side can raise this issue during the next session of PACE, if it wishes, APA reported.
